Wer ist hier? 1 Gäste
varcade
|
|
andy1979 |
Geschrieben am 04.02.2010 00000002 19:54
|
![]() Jung Mitglied ![]() Beiträge: 31 Registriert am: 28.10.09 Fusioneer: 15 years 6 months 1 weeks 9 days 2 hours 47 minutes 4 seconds |
was hat das denn zu beuten kann ich dagegen was machen???? Notice: Undefined index: current in /srv/www/htdocs/geändert/html/infusions/varcade/tournament_history.php on line 45 |
|
|
SC-Ad-Bot | Advertisement |
| |
mrburns |
Geschrieben am 04.02.2010 00000002 20:07
|
![]() Mitglied ![]() Beiträge: 120 Registriert am: 03.03.09 Fusioneer: 16 years 2 months 0 weeks 4 days 17 hours 32 minutes 33 seconds |
die frage ist dabei wie sieht denn line 45 aus das solltest du vielleicht mal dazu posten gruss christian |
|
|
andy1979 |
Geschrieben am 04.02.2010 00000002 20:33
|
![]() Jung Mitglied ![]() Beiträge: 31 Registriert am: 28.10.09 Fusioneer: 15 years 6 months 1 weeks 9 days 2 hours 47 minutes 4 seconds |
sorry ich poste mal alles sehe beim zählen nicht durch [geshi=php]<?php /*-------------------------------------------------------+ | PHP-Fusion Content Management System | Copyright © 2002 - 2008 Nick Jones | http://www.php-fusion.co.uk/ +--------------------------------------------------------+ | Author: Domi & fetloser | www.venue.nu +--------------------------------------------------------+ | This program is released as free software under the | Affero GPL license. You can redistribute it and/or | modify it under the terms of this license which you | can read by viewing the included agpl.txt or online | at www.gnu.org/licenses/agpl.html. Removal of this | copyright header is strictly prohibited without | written permission from the original author(s). +--------------------------------------------------------*/ if (!defined("IN_FUSION")) { die("Access Denied"); } if (!defined("LANGUAGE")) { // PHPFusion environment $this_lang = str_replace("/", "", LOCALESET); if (file_exists(INFUSIONS."varcade/locale/".$this_lang.".php")) { include INFUSIONS."varcade/locale/".$this_lang.".php"; } else { include INFUSIONS."varcade/locale/English.php"; } } else { // mFusion environment $this_lang = LANGUAGE; if (file_exists(INFUSIONS."varcade/locale/".$this_lang.".php")) { include INFUSIONS."varcade/locale/".$this_lang.".php"; } else { include INFUSIONS."varcade/locale/English.php"; } } $varcsettings = dbarray(dbquery("SELECT * FROM ".DB_VARCADE_SETTINGS)); $currenttime = time(); $tourdata = dbarray(dbquery("SELECT * FROM ".DB_VARCADE_TOURNAMENTS." ORDER BY id DESC LIMIT 1")); if ($currenttime > $tourdata['tour_enddate']) { $query = dbquery ("SELECT * FROM ".DB_VARCADE_GAMES." WHERE status='2' ORDER BY RAND() limit 0,1") ; $rows = dbarray($query); $expiredate = time()+432000; $tour_game = $rows['lid']; $tour_title = $rows['title']; $tour_icon = $rows['icon']; $tour_flash = $rows['flash']; $tour_winner = $locale['TOUR003']; $tour_score = "0"; $tour_players = "0"; $tour_reverse = $rows['reverse']; $tour_startdate = $currenttime; $tour_enddate = $expiredate; $result = dbquery("INSERT INTO ".DB_VARCADE_TOURNAMENTS." VALUES('', '".$tour_game."', '".$tour_title."', '".$tour_icon."', '".$tour_flash."', '".$tour_winner."', '".$tour_score."', '".$tour_players."', '".$tour_reverse."', '".$tour_startdate."', '".$tour_enddate."')"); } if ($varcsettings['popup']=="1") { $gamelink = "<a href='#' onclick=window.open('".INFUSIONS."varcade/arcade.php?p=1&game=".$tourdata['tour_game']."','VArcpopup','scrollbars=yes,resizable=yes,width=800,height=700')>"; } else { $gamelink = "<a href='".INFUSIONS."varcade/arcade.php?game=".$tourdata['tour_game']."'>"; } $tourlink = trimlink($tourdata['tour_title'], 20); echo "<table cellpadding='0' cellspacing='1' border='0' width='100%'><tr valign='top'><td> <table cellpadding='4' cellspacing='1' border='0' width='98%'> <tr valign='middle' align='center'> <td colspan='4' width='50%' class='tbl2'>"; echo $gamelink."<b>".$tourlink."</b></a><br />"; echo "</td><td colspan='4' width='50%' class='tbl2'><a href='".INFUSIONS."varcade/tournament_history.php?current=".$tourdata['tour_game']."'>".$locale['TOUR008']."</a></td> </tr> <tr valign='top'>"; echo "<td colspan='4' width='50%'> <div class='small' style='height: 75px;'>"; echo $gamelink; echo '<img src="'.INFUSIONS.'varcade/uploads/thumb/'.$tourdata['tour_icon'].'" align="right" valign="center" hspace="5" vspace="5" style="border: 0px;" border="0"/></a>'; echo $gamelink; echo '<img src="'.INFUSIONS.'varcade/uploads/thumb/'.$tourdata['tour_icon'].'" align="left" valign="center" hspace="5" vspace="5" style="border: 0px;" border="0"/></a>'; echo "<center>"; echo $locale['TOUR002']." <br /> ".$tourdata['tour_winner']; echo "<br />".$locale['TOUR004']." ".$tourdata['tour_score']." ".$locale['TOUR005']; echo "<br />".$locale['TOUR006']." ".$tourdata['tour_players']." ".$locale['TOUR007']; echo "<br /><br /><center>".showdate('forumdate', $tourdata['tour_startdate'])." <--> ".showdate('forumdate', $tourdata['tour_enddate'])."</center>"; echo "</div></td>"; echo "<td colspan='4' width='50%'> <div class='small' style='height: 75px;'>"; echo "<a href='".INFUSIONS."varcade/tournament_history.php?current=".$tourdata['tour_game']."'><img src='".INFUSIONS."varcade/img/tournament1.png' align='right' hspace='5' vspace='5' style='border: 0px;' border='0'/></a>"; echo "<table align='left' cellpadding='0' cellspacing='1' width='70%'>"; echo '<tr> <td class="tbl2" width="50"><span class="small"><b>'.$locale['TOUR009'].'</b></span></td> <td class="tbl2" width="50"><span class="small"><b>'.$locale['TOUR010'].'</b></span></td> </tr>'; $result = dbquery("SELECT * FROM ".DB_VARCADE_TOURNAMENTS." WHERE tour_enddate < ".$currenttime." ORDER BY id DESC LIMIT 0,4"); while ($data = dbarray($result)) { $result2=dbquery("SELECT user_id FROM ".DB_USERS." WHERE user_name='".$data['tour_winner']."'"); $data2 = dbarray($result2); $tourname = trimlink($data['tour_title'], 20); $tourwinner = trimlink($data['tour_winner'], 10); echo '<tr> <td align="left"><a href="'.INFUSIONS.'varcade/tournament_history.php?gameid='.$data['tour_game'].'">'.$tourname.'</a></td> <td align="center"><a href="'.INFUSIONS.'varcade/player_hiscore.php?name='.$data['tour_winner'].'&id='.$data2['user_id'].'&rowstart=0">'.$tourwinner.'</a></td> </tr>'; } echo "</div></td></table>"; echo "</td></tr></table></table></center>\n"; ?>[/geshi] |
|
|
emblinux |
Geschrieben am 04.02.2010 00000002 20:43
|
![]() Seiten Administrator ![]() Beiträge: 3813 Registriert am: 04.10.08 Fusioneer: 16 years 7 months 0 weeks 2 days 13 hours 46 minutes 15 seconds |
ist das auch die richtige Datei ? Denn ich kann dort keinen index 'current' finden. Ausserdem benutze in Zukunft die entsprechenden BBCodes, wenn du Codeschnipsel postest, damit man es auch lesen kann, sonst stören die Smileys! Und ein wenig Zählen wird wohl drinn sein, wenn man Hilfe haben möchte. |
|
|
Jumpstyledenny |
Geschrieben am 04.02.2010 00000002 21:24
|
![]() Jung Mitglied ![]() Beiträge: 15 Registriert am: 03.02.10 Fusioneer: 15 years 3 months 0 weeks 2 days 15 hours 23 minutes 45 seconds |
ich habe mal ne frage . wen wir versuchen die games bei uns zu spielen kommt immer , Opps! Es ist ein Fehler aufgetreten! Die Spiel-ID ist in der Datenbank nicht vorhanden! Dies kann passieren, wenn eine falsche ID zum Spielen gesendet wird. was haben wir falsch gemacht |
|
|
mrburns |
Geschrieben am 05.02.2010 00000002 10:56
|
![]() Mitglied ![]() Beiträge: 120 Registriert am: 03.03.09 Fusioneer: 16 years 2 months 0 weeks 4 days 17 hours 32 minutes 33 seconds |
@andy1979 das auf jeden fall schon mal die falsche php datei die du hier als code reingesetzt hast und das mit zählen muss schlechter scherz sein besorg dir mal nen richtiges php programm dann stehen die zeilen auch gleich mit ner zahl vor da gruss christian Bearbeitet von mrburns am 05.02.2010 00000002 11:14 |
|
|
andy1979 |
Geschrieben am 05.02.2010 00000002 22:05
|
![]() Jung Mitglied ![]() Beiträge: 31 Registriert am: 28.10.09 Fusioneer: 15 years 6 months 1 weeks 9 days 2 hours 47 minutes 4 seconds |
welche soll das den sein |
|
|
emblinux |
Geschrieben am 05.02.2010 00000002 22:08
|
![]() Seiten Administrator ![]() Beiträge: 3813 Registriert am: 04.10.08 Fusioneer: 16 years 7 months 0 weeks 2 days 13 hours 46 minutes 15 seconds |
Die Meldung lautet: Notice: Undefined index: current in /srv/www/htdocs/geändert/html/infusions/varcade/tournament_history.php on line 45 also liegt das Problem in der Datei tournament_history.php und dort die Zeile 45. Und diese sollst du lediglich mal hier posten. Ist doch gar nicht so schwer...oder? |
|
|
mrburns |
Geschrieben am 05.02.2010 00000002 22:09
|
![]() Mitglied ![]() Beiträge: 120 Registriert am: 03.03.09 Fusioneer: 16 years 2 months 0 weeks 4 days 17 hours 32 minutes 33 seconds |
varcade/tournament_history.php on line 45 diese findest du in infusion varcade und wenn nicht komplett den namen zeigt ist es die zweite tournament gruss christian |
|
|
andy1979 |
Geschrieben am 05.02.2010 00000002 22:13
|
![]() Jung Mitglied ![]() Beiträge: 31 Registriert am: 28.10.09 Fusioneer: 15 years 6 months 1 weeks 9 days 2 hours 47 minutes 4 seconds |
zeile 45 müßte das sein $where = "WHERE game_id = '".$_GET['current']."'"; tournament_history is aus der datei müßte richtig sein oder |
|
|
emblinux |
Geschrieben am 05.02.2010 00000002 22:15
|
![]() Seiten Administrator ![]() Beiträge: 3813 Registriert am: 04.10.08 Fusioneer: 16 years 7 months 0 weeks 2 days 13 hours 46 minutes 15 seconds |
Dann ändere diese Zeile in: Code Download Code if ( isset($_GET['current']) && isNum($_GET['current']) ) |
|
|
andy1979 |
Geschrieben am 05.02.2010 00000002 22:20
|
![]() Jung Mitglied ![]() Beiträge: 31 Registriert am: 28.10.09 Fusioneer: 15 years 6 months 1 weeks 9 days 2 hours 47 minutes 4 seconds |
jetztkommt zeile 51 Code Download Code $hiscorex = dbquery("SELECT DISTINCT game_id, player_id, game_score, score_date FROM ".DB_VARCADE_TOURNAMENT_SCORES." ".$where." ORDER BY game_score DESC LIMIT 0,25"); |
|
|
emblinux |
Geschrieben am 05.02.2010 00000002 22:23
|
![]() Seiten Administrator ![]() Beiträge: 3813 Registriert am: 04.10.08 Fusioneer: 16 years 7 months 0 weeks 2 days 13 hours 46 minutes 15 seconds |
wahrscheinlich kennt er jetzt die Variable $where nicht. Also ändere den vorherigen Code nochmal um in: Code Download Code $where = ""; Oder wie lautete diese Warning? |
|
|
mrburns |
Geschrieben am 05.02.2010 00000002 22:25
|
![]() Mitglied ![]() Beiträge: 120 Registriert am: 03.03.09 Fusioneer: 16 years 2 months 0 weeks 4 days 17 hours 32 minutes 33 seconds |
die sollte so aussehen[geshi=php]$hiscorex = dbquery("SELECT DISTINCT game_id, player_id, game_score, score_date FROM ".$db_prefix."varcade_tournament_scores ".$where." ORDER BY game_score DESC LIMIT 0,25");[/geshi] |
|
|
andy1979 |
Geschrieben am 05.02.2010 00000002 22:25
|
![]() Jung Mitglied ![]() Beiträge: 31 Registriert am: 28.10.09 Fusioneer: 15 years 6 months 1 weeks 9 days 2 hours 47 minutes 4 seconds |
ja danke funktioniert fehler is weg |
|
|
emblinux |
Geschrieben am 05.02.2010 00000002 22:27
|
![]() Seiten Administrator ![]() Beiträge: 3813 Registriert am: 04.10.08 Fusioneer: 16 years 7 months 0 weeks 2 days 13 hours 46 minutes 15 seconds |
Zitat mrburns schrieb: die sollte so aussehen[geshi=php]$hiscorex = dbquery("SELECT DISTINCT game_id, player_id, game_score, score_date FROM ".$db_prefix."varcade_tournament_scores ".$where." ORDER BY game_score DESC LIMIT 0,25");[/geshi] öhm... nein! Die Anfrage war schon so richtig, es ging eher um die Variable $where, wleche nicht initialisiert war. |
|
Springe ins Forum: |
Ähnliche Themen
Thema | Forum | Antworten | Letzter Beitrag |
---|---|---|---|
VArcade Anleitungshilfe | Allgemeine Support Fragen | 2 | 01.07.2015 00000007 06:06 |
VArcade Spiele YetiGames GESUCHT!!!! HELP | Games, Spiele & Co. | 1 | 11.04.2014 00000004 22:14 |
VArcade 2.1 Administration | Games, Spiele & Co. | 3 | 03.01.2013 00000001 20:00 |
varcade und scoresystem | Allgemeine Support Fragen | 1 | 04.07.2012 00000007 13:21 |
VArcade 2.1 | Games, Spiele & Co. | 4 | 07.06.2012 00000006 19:50 |